Biography - Michael Maas

 




  Michael Maas, a native of the upper mid-west, draws his inspiration from the beauty of creation and of fond memories throughout his life. While growing up in a small Minnesota town, his ability to see the beauty in the most simple of his surroundings was sometimes mistaken for idle daydreaming. Over the years, his appreciation and desire to express these visual images has culminated into a career of creating his distinctive artwork.

Through composition, color, and a general sense of realism, Michael likes to capture the feeling of the moment, place, or subject, and transfer that impression into his paintings.
 
 
 
"My goal is not to create a painting that looks like a photograph, but to create a painting that reflects the feeling of the moment and maintains a "painted" quality. I will work on a painting just long enough to capture what I think will express the inspiration that led me to create the painting," says Maas.

 
  "I have always admired the great impresssionist painters of the past and their ability to interpret what they saw, while conveying their inspiration at the same time. In my own unique style of painting that I describe as "impressionistic realism", I attempt to do the same." Acrylic paints and pastels are his current media of choice. His subject matter comes primarily from Minnesota and the upper mid-west.

From his original works of art, Michael Maas creates limited edition signed and numbered fine art giclee prints of his distinctive paintings. He also creates and sells original and commissioned pieces of his artwork.
